Why is Portuguese Increasingly Important in the Age of Globalization?

In today's era of globalization, the ability to speak a foreign language is an invaluable asset, especially in the fields of business, diplomacy, and law. One language that is gaining increasing attention is Portuguese. Portuguese-speaking countries such as Brazil, Portugal, and Angola now play an important role in the global economy, so an understanding of the language is becoming increasingly necessary. If you want to pursue an international career, enrolling in a relevant language course is the way to go.

Portuguese courses not only offer grammar and vocabulary learning, but also provide insight into the culture attached to the language. This is especially important for those who want to become Portuguese interpreters, as accurate interpretation requires a deep understanding of the cultural context. In international business, education or legal translation, these skills can add significant value.

Portuguese sworn translation is becoming increasingly important in international relations, especially in the fields of law and diplomacy. As a sworn translator, you are responsible for providing legally valid translations that can be used in court proceedings or business transactions. Therefore, in-depth training is essential to ensure accuracy and reliability in every translation performed.

The demand for professional Portuguese interpreters is also increasing in various sectors. This is driven by the development of international cooperation among countries that use Portuguese as an official language. The Importance of Sworn Translation

Sworn Portuguese translation is indispensable in various official documents, such as business contracts, certificates and legal documents. As a sworn translator, you will be instrumental in ensuring the accuracy of the translation, which is legal and can be used in court or international transactions. A comprehensive language course can prepare you for this important role.

Cultural Skills in Translation

To be a successful translator, an understanding of the culture of Portuguese-speaking countries is necessary. Culture often affects the way language is used, and mistakes in cultural interpretation can be fatal in a business or diplomatic context.
